Kids Talk Death: The Deadly Curious Q&A
from It's A Death Sentence: An Unexpectedly Funny, Deeply Human Podcast About Death & Life
This episode felt different because we handed the big questions over to the children.In this special episode of It’s a Death Sentence, we run a kids’ workshop and ask young people what they think about death, grief, the afterlife, funerals, and how they’d support a friend who is sad.What You’ll Discover- Honest Answers from Children: What they believe happens when we die, whether they think there’s a heaven or hell, and how they’d comfort someone who is grieving.- The Curious Questions Kids Ask: Their raw, thoughtful, and often surprisingly funny takes on death and what comes after.- The Kids Turn the Tables: The curious and brilliant questions the children asked us in return.Their answers are honest, sometimes humorous, and often wiser than we expect. It’s a gentle reminder that death doesn’t have to be a scary or forbidden topic - it can be discussed with care, curiosity, and even hope. This episode was recorded as part of a school pilot on death education, showing how naturally young people engage when given a safe space to talk.It's A Death Sentence shares real stories of life after loss and is produced by Urban Podcasts.
